By the mysteries of the mind, the nearer I draw to Father God, the more everything else surrounding Him fades away, until at last, in the heady intimacy of His presence, it is just my God and me. My purpose is not to examine Him or to converse with Him. I am there to reverently adore Him, to bow before His sovereign majesty, and to reestablish, for my fleshly benefit, that He alone is God and I am but His servant.

There is no one else around. There are no other sounds or sights to distract. There is just my reverent humility at the feet of my God and Father.

And I depart the experience filled with Him.
